■Timer settings
A maximum of 15 charge schedules can be registered.
■ To make sure that the charging timer function operates correctly
Check the following items.
●Adjust the clock to the correct time ( →P. 185)
● Check that the power switch is turned off
● After registering the charge schedule, connect the charging cable
The charging start time is determined based on the charge schedule at the
time that the charging cable was connected.
● After connecting the charging cable, check that the charging indicator
flashes ( →P. 106)
● Do not use an outlet that has a power cut off function (including a timer func-
tion)
Use an outlet that constantly supplies electricity. For outlets where the
power is cut off due to a timer function, etc., charging may not be carried
out according to plan if the power is cut off during the set time.
■ When the charging cable rema ins connected to the vehicle
Even if multiple consecutive charge schedules are registered, the next
charge will not be carried out according to the timer until the charging cable is
removed and reconnected after charging completes. Also, when the hybrid
battery (traction battery) is fully charged, charging according to the timer will
not be carried out.
■ “Climate Prep”
●When the air conditioning-linked setting is turned on, the air conditioning
operates until the set departure time. T herefore, the air conditioning will con-
sume electricity and charging may not complete by the set departure time.
● If the hybrid battery (traction battery) is fully charged, charging will not be
carried out, even if the charge schedule is set. However, if “Climate Prep” is
turned on, the air conditioning will operate only once when it nears the time
set in “Departure”. If this occurs, the air conditioning will consume electricity
and the remaining charge of the hybrid battery (traction battery) when
departing may be decreased.

3. Instrument cluster
Combination meter
The units used on the display may differ depending on the target region.
Main display (→P. 196)
The main display shows basic information related to driving, such as the
vehicle speed and remaining fuel amount.
Multi-information display ( →P. 205)
The multi-information display shows information which makes the vehicle
convenient-to-use, such as the hybrid system operation condition, electric-
ity consumption and fuel consumption history. Also, the operation contents
of the driving support systems and the combination meter display settings
can be changed by switching to the settings screen.
Warning lights and indicators (→ P. 188)
The warning lights and indicators comes on or flashes to indicate problems
with the vehicle or to show the operation status of the vehicle’s systems.
Clock (→P. 185)
The large meter uses 2 liquid crys tal displays to display informa-
tion such as the vehicle condition , driving status, electricity con-
sumption and fuel consumption.

■The meters and display illuminate when
The power switch is in ON mode.
■ Adjusting the instrument cluster brightness (→P. 182)
● The brightness levels that can be selected differ depending on whether the
tail lights are on and surrounding brightness levels, as shown in the table
below.
*: 22 levels of the brightness are displayed on the setting screen. However,
the brightness setting will be the brightest when other than 1st level (the
darkest) is selected. If other than 1st or 22nd level is selected, when the
tail lights are turned on in a dark place, the instrument cluster brightness
setting will be the selected level.
● If the taillights are illuminated in a dark environment, the instrument cluster
light dims. However, when the brightness of the instrument cluster is set to
minimum or maximum (1st or 22nd level of the instrument cluster bright-
ness), even if the taillights are illuminated, the instrument cluster light will
not dim.
■ When disconnecting and reconnect ing 12-volt battery terminals
The settings of the clock will be reset.
■ Calendar settings
●Until the calendar settings are set, the check screen is displayed every time
the power switch is turned to ON mode.
● After the calendar information is set, it can be changed in the “Meter Cus-
tomize” settings. ( →P. 233)

■Meter display
When the power switch is turned off, each display will turn off as follows.
●The shift position indicator will turn off after approximately 2 seconds.
● The multi-information display, clock, etc. will turn off after approximately 30
seconds.
(Each display will also turn off immediately if a door is locked before 30 sec-
onds has elapsed.)

WARNING
■When starting the hybrid system
Always start the hybrid system while sitting in the driver’s seat. Do not
depress the accelerator pedal while starting the hybrid system under any
circumstances.
Doing so may cause an accident resulting in death or serious injury.
■ Stopping the hybrid system in an emergency
● If you want to stop the hybrid system in an emergency while driving the
vehicle, press and hold the power switch for more than 2 seconds, or
press it briefly 3 times or more in succession. ( →P. 645)
However, do not touch the power switch while driving except in an emer-
gency. Turning the hybrid system off while driving will not cause loss of
steering or braking control, however, power assist to the steering will be
lost. This will make it more difficult to steer smoothly, so you should pull
over and stop the vehicle as soon as it is safe to do so.
● If the power switch is operated while the vehicle is running, a warning
message will be shown on the multi-information display and a buzzer
sounds.
● When restarting the hybrid system after an emergency shutdown while
driving, press the power switch. When restarting the hybrid system after
stopping the vehicle, change the shift position to P and then press the
power switch.
